About Botfontein Smallholdings
Botfontein Smallholdings is a unique area located in the Brackenfell region of Cape Town, offering a blend of rural charm and suburban convenience. Residents can enjoy large plots of land, providing a sense of space and privacy not typically found in urban environments.
The neighbourhood is characterized by its serene atmosphere while being well-connected to both Brackenfell and the wider Cape Town area. This peaceful setting, combined with accessibility to urban amenities, makes it an attractive option for families and those seeking a quieter lifestyle balance.
